Nature's Commercial Value

Cooling
Integrating new constructed wetlands with commercial or industrial cooling systems can provide year-round efficient cooling, eliminating water abstraction and chiller use.
Applicable for data centres, energy, and industrial cooling.

Water Purification
Constructed wetlands can be used to treat agricultural runoff can minimise algal blooms or, as part of a larger system, process sewage.
Applicable for sewage treatment plants, water intensive manufacturing, and residential developments.

Water Management
Wetlands can replenish groundwater stores to prevent droughts and store excess water during floods.
Applicable for asset owners who want to protect against flooding and traditional agriculture that needs to prepare for increasing droughts.

Soil Management
Regenerative agriculture, including agroforestry, can be used to increase the climate resilience of supply chains.
Applicable to agricultural supply chains across the world.
